SuperSlicer vs. Alternatives: Choose the Best Slicer for YouChoosing the right slicer is one of the most important decisions for 3D printing success. A slicer translates your 3D model into machine instructions (G-code) the printer understands — affecting print quality, speed, reliability, and ease of use. This article compares SuperSlicer with several popular alternatives, highlights strengths and trade-offs, and helps you decide which slicer best fits your needs and workflow.
Quick summary
- SuperSlicer: powerful, highly configurable fork of PrusaSlicer with advanced features for experienced users. Best for tinkerers who want granular control and cutting-edge features.
- PrusaSlicer: user-friendly, well-supported by Prusa; excellent for Prusa hardware and those wanting a balance between simplicity and control.
- Cura: broadly used, plugin-friendly, good for beginners and hobbyists; extensive community profiles and frequent updates.
- Simplify3D: commercial, fast slicing and granular support control, but no longer actively developed; still favored by users wanting deterministic behavior and advanced support editing.
- ChiTuBox / Lychee / Formware: stronger in resin (SLA/DLP) workflows; tailored features for supports, hollowing, and print preparation for resin printers.
- Kiri:Moto / OctoPrint slicers: web-based or integrated; useful when slicing remotely or integrating with printer server ecosystems.
How to evaluate a slicer — the important factors
- Ease of use: interface clarity, default profiles for your printer and filament.
- Print quality: how well the slicer’s algorithms handle bridging, overhangs, retraction, and seam placement.
- Control & customization: ability to tweak per-region/per-object settings, advanced extrusion options, and custom G-code.
- Speed & resource use: slicing time and memory demands for large models.
- Support generation: automatic supports, tree supports, manual editing.
- Multi-material / multi-extruder support: tool-change handling, purge towers, wipes.
- Community & profiles: availability of verified profiles for printers and filaments.
- Updates & longevity: active development, bug fixes, new features.
- Integration: compatibility with printer firmware, OctoPrint, printer host software, or cloud services.
- Cost & license: free/open-source vs. commercial.
SuperSlicer — strengths and trade-offs
Strengths
- Granular control: SuperSlicer exposes a vast array of settings (many beyond PrusaSlicer), including per-object modifiers, pressure advance/e-steps tuning, seam placement strategies, and multiple infill options.
- Advanced experimental features: ironing, variable layer height improvements, custom support shapes, ironing flow control, input shaping helpers, and more.
- Profiles and presets: strong community-shared profiles for many printers; can import PrusaSlicer profiles.
- Open-source and actively developed: forks evolve quickly and incorporate community-requested features.
- G-code preview and simulation: detailed preview with time/filament estimates and visualized toolpaths.
Trade-offs
- Complexity: the sheer number of options can overwhelm beginners. Default profiles are decent, but unlocking the best results often requires experience.
- UI learning curve: menus and terminology can be dense; finding the right parameter may take time.
- Occasional instability: rapid feature additions can introduce bugs; user must update cautiously and maintain backups of profiles.
PrusaSlicer — who it’s for
- Best for users of Prusa printers and those who want a reliable, approachable slicer with excellent defaults.
- Pros: polished UI, curated profiles, reliable print settings, direct firmware compatibility, excellent documentation.
- Cons: less experimental than SuperSlicer; fewer cutting-edge or highly granular knobs (though still very powerful).
Cura — who it’s for
- Best for broad compatibility and plugin-driven workflows; widely used by hobbyists and beginners.
- Pros: intuitive UI, many community profiles, Marketplace plugins, strong meshing and support generation, fast slicing on large models.
- Cons: some settings hidden or harder to discover; default settings can vary by printer profile; advanced users may find limited low-level control compared to SuperSlicer.
Simplify3D — who it’s for
- Still used by advanced users who value its deterministic slicing, manual support sculpting, and performance.
- Pros: very fast slicing, powerful manual support controls, predictable output.
- Cons: commercial license, no active development/updates for years, less community momentum.
Resin slicers (ChiTuBox, Lychee, Formware) — note on workflow difference
- These are specialized for SLA/DLP/MSLA printers; they handle layer curing specifics, supports suited to resin, hollowing, drains, and print orientation strategies unique to photopolymer processes. SuperSlicer/PrusaSlicer/Cura are focused on FDM/FFF filament printers.
Feature comparison
Feature | SuperSlicer | PrusaSlicer | Cura | Simplify3D |
---|---|---|---|---|
Ease of use | Medium | High | High | Medium |
Granular control | Very High | High | Medium | High |
Community profiles | High | High (Prusa ecosystem) | High | Medium |
Advanced infill / modifiers | Yes | Yes | Yes | Yes |
Support editing | Good | Good | Good | Excellent (manual) |
Active development | Yes (fast) | Yes | Yes | No |
Cost | Free/Open-source | Free/Open-source | Free/Open-source | Commercial |
Typical use-cases & recommendations
- You’re a beginner learning 3D printing: start with PrusaSlicer (if on Prusa) or Cura for its approachable interface and strong defaults.
- You want absolute control and are comfortable tuning lots of parameters: choose SuperSlicer.
- You use multiple printer brands and want marketplace plugins and a broad set of profiles: Cura.
- You value deterministic slicing and manual support sculpting and are okay with a paid product: Simplify3D might fit, but be aware of stagnant development.
- You print resin models: pick a resin-focused slicer like ChiTuBox or Lychee.
Tips for migrating and testing slicers
- Keep a baseline: print a standard calibration model (benchy, calibration cube, overhang test) with each slicer to compare results.
- Import/export profiles: many slicers can import PrusaSlicer or Cura profiles; use this to jump-start settings.
- Change one parameter at a time: isolate which setting affects results most.
- Use community profiles: start from trusted profiles for your printer and filament.
- Backup presets and custom profiles before upgrading or switching.
Final decision guide
- If you enjoy tuning and want the latest, deepest features: choose SuperSlicer.
- If you want a stable, friendly experience, especially with Prusa hardware: choose PrusaSlicer.
- If you want broad compatibility, plugins, and an easy entry point: choose Cura.
- If you need precise manual support control and deterministic results and don’t mind a paid, stagnating product: consider Simplify3D.
- For resin printing, use a dedicated resin slicer.
SuperSlicer stands out for power and configurability; alternatives prioritize ease, ecosystem integration, or specialty workflows. Run side-by-side tests with calibration prints to see which slicer’s defaults and tuning you prefer for your printer and typical models.